The 2024 Ontario Sunshine List shows that the average and median salaries for a Senior Manager of Equity Services are $142,388.77 and $128,725.93, respectively.
In 2024, Tonya Long, holding the position of Senior Manager, Compensation, Pay Equity at the Durham Catholic District School Board received the highest salary of $189,635.34 among similar positions in Ontario public organizations. Lynn Garrioch, serving as the Senior Manager of Equity Services at Waterloo Catholic District School Board , earned the highest salary of $179,679.86 among individuals in the same position across public organizations in Ontario during that year.
In the year 2024, the highest-paying organizations for Senior Manager of Equity Services and similar positions in the Ontario were as follows: Durham Catholic District School Board with an average pay of $189,635.34; Waterloo Catholic District School Board with an average pay of $179,679.86; Halton Catholic District School Board with an average pay of $166,980.85; Ontario Power Generation with an average pay of $162,744.20; and City of Toronto - Public Library Board with an average pay of $134,585.44.
A total of 9 organizations had employees who held comparable positions as mentioned in the Ontario Sunshine list.
In the year 2024, the highest-paying sector or industries for Senior Manager of Equity Services and similar positions in the Ontario were as follows: School Boards with an average pay of $178,765.35; Ontario Power Generation with an average pay of $162,744.20; and Municipalities and Services with an average pay of $134,585.44.
There were 7 sectors where employees held similar positions, as indicated in the Ontario Sunshine list.
The 2024 Ontario Sunshine List indicates that the representation of gender diversity in Senior Manager of Equity Services is 15.38% male and 84.62% female, respectively.
